Let me say this right off, The Hermit
of Humbug Mountain is one of the most delightful reads
I have read in a long time. Entertainment at its max.
Two young people, Noah and his younger sister Abby are the
main characters of this adventure.
The entire family is in the midst of overcoming
the death of their Mom and the adventure begins as Dad brings
a new woman into their lives, one that Noah is not ready
to accept.
Noah decides to run away from home and is joined by his
sister, the logical one of the two. Here is where the story
begins as they travel to Humbug Mountain to await the dawn
of a new day and execute their plan of escape.
Here, Abby is kidnapped and Noah goes on a guest to find
his sister. Little did the two of them know they had been
chosen to fight Spid, a terrible demon that has been waiting
for a certain time to take over the world and throw it into
darkness. It is their destiny to fight against this evil
and save the world.
You are just delighted with the different characters that
the authors introduce. There is an entire community of strange
beings living inside Humbug Mountain, just waiting for you
to enjoy them. A book that is sure to entertain the reader,
with a lot of mystery, adventure and supernatural.
A very good read. Recommended!
~Shirley Johnson/Reviewer

I will never be able to drive through the
sahdy curves of Humbug Mountain again without looking up
into its misty forest and wondering what might be hidden
there.
The book The Hermit of Humbug Mountain
by Mike Nettleton & Carolyn Rose is a fantasy story
of two local runaway teens who find themselves drawn into
the mountain and set on a mission to save the world from
the forces of Spid the Devious, Grand Exalted Garboon of
the Land Below Skin, the Land of Beneath, and his army of
trolls, ogres, Bansees, demons, gronks, skrees, grammits,
and… you get the picture.
Noah and his sister Abby are separated in
the mountain and meet unlikely allies and enemies, as they
move towards the final battle for the unsuspecting people
of the land Above Skin, or us, as the surface dwellers.
A vanished drummer, a hermit of local legend,
a sword-carrying warrior girl, Darksuckers, and a little
gray guy named Uh-oh, reveal themselves one by one as Noah
and Abby learn to trust and find faith in friendship and
themselves. I would tell you more, or maybe not, but I haven’t
yet finished reading the book and I won’t spoil it
for myself. So check it out for yourself.
~ Marion F. Romero, Reviewer for Port
